Chapter 83

Xi Jia didn't hear, looking at the scenery outside her side window, thinking about her illness.

"Xi Jia." Zhou Mingqian was in the wrong first, but he spoke with restraint.

But there was still no response.

"Xi Jia!" Zhou Mingqian suppressed his emotions and raised his voice slightly.

Xi Jia vaguely heard someone calling her. She turned around and looked Zhou Mingqian up and down. "Say what you have to say!"

Zhou Mingqian calmed his breathing and told himself not to stoop to the level of this kind of woman. He repeated what he had just said, asking her to send him the list that evening.

Xi Jia: "Those notes are priceless to me. Can you afford to pay for them?" She was too lazy to argue with him and turned her face away to look at the roadside scenery.

The round trip from the film set to the hotel took more than an hour.

When Xi Jia returned to the studio, it was already past ten o'clock, and the sun was shining brightly. Her several notebooks, each page separated, were laid out on the stone bench to dry.

Mo Yushen stood to the side, guarding these notes, occasionally turning the pages.

There was a breeze by the lake, so he weighed it down with clean pebbles.

His name appeared on the page, and he started reading from the beginning.

This is a monologue by Xi Jia. It was recorded last night.

My hearing has deteriorated again.

I was having dinner with Mo Yushen at the restaurant downstairs just now. I saw him open his mouth to speak, but I couldn't hear what he said.

Hopefully, it's because the store is too noisy.

The filming of "The Rest of My Life" is already more than halfway through, and the scenes will be completed in another month.

The days I spend with Mo Yushen are becoming fewer and fewer.

That evening, we walked to visit Grandma. I deliberately walked very, very slowly, but I still made it to the end.

The old lady asked me when I would hold my wedding with Mo Yushen, so that I could go to Beijing for a visit while she could still walk.

I told Grandma I'd wait until I was done with my work.

Actually, the wedding will not take place.

I also want to wear a wedding dress and have Mo Yushen lead me down that long red carpet. But like this, I can't stay with him for long.

My second brother told me that my illness wasn't life-threatening. Even if he wasn't telling the truth, I knew that in a few months, when my condition worsened, I'd be no different from someone who was mentally challenged.

I don't want people to speculate and gossip behind my back, saying that Mo Yushen would even marry a fool for the sake of a political marriage.

My marriage to him involved no exchange of benefits; at most, it was a powerful alliance, but outsiders wouldn't believe it. Now that he's competing with Mo Lian for the Mo Group, even fewer people will believe the purity of this marriage.

He's so good, he deserves better.

From now on, I will have my own life, and Mo Yushen will also have his own life to live.

I wonder what kind of wife he'll find in the future, how many children they'll have. He'll definitely be a good husband and a good father. By then, he probably won't think about me much anymore.

I need to get up early tomorrow to take photos by the lake. Hopefully, Zhou, that irritable guy, will take his medication before going out. Goodnight.

Mo Yushen stared at this page in a daze for a long time. Then he sent Xi Jia a message: "When are you coming back?"

Xi Jia had just gotten her phone back from Yu An and unlocked it when a message came in.

Xi Jia: [Turns around.]

Mo Yushen turned around, and Xi Jia was already walking over from the studio. Mo Yushen put away his phone and called to Jiang Qin, "Come here and turn the page."

He walked towards Xi Jia.

Surrounded by members of the film crew, Xi Jia greeted Mo Yushen politely, "Mr. Mo."

Mo Yushen didn't respond, but reached out and hugged her.

The people around were petrified.

Chapter Fifty

Xi Jia instinctively tried to push Mo Yushen away, but the next second, she received a burning kiss on her forehead.

"If you keep doing this, all my efforts will be for nothing." Xi Jia pinched Mo Yushen's waist. She didn't realize that her tone was coquettish.

Being stared at by so many people, Xi Jia's ears turned slightly red, and she hadn't been this happy in a long time.

Mo Yushen lowered his eyes. "You've dried your notebook; it's airing out to dry."

Xi Jia nodded, her eyes fixed on the buttons of his shirt, her heart pounding with emotion, still not quite calm.

The scenario that appeared in her domineering CEO drama actually happened to her.

If only she had a memory, this scene would be enough for her to recall for many years, until she grows old.

"Husband." Xi Jia suddenly looked up, grabbed Mo Yushen's neck, and kissed him on tiptoe. This was the first time she had taken the initiative to give a deep kiss.

Those around them suddenly realized that Xi Jia's non-celebrity husband was Mo Yushen. Some people screamed and cheered.

The infatuated girl was secretly crying while gossiping and recording videos.

Xi Jia wasn't lingering. After the kiss ended, she gracefully withdrew from the embrace and went to look at her precious notebooks.

Kissing in public still made Mo Yushen a little uncomfortable, but he could only pretend to be calm. "It's my treat tonight. You can choose any restaurant on the food street." He paused slightly, "Don't spread the video."

Someone joked, "Mr. Mo, you'll have to pay us hush money. One meal isn't enough."

While everyone was laughing and joking over there, the area in front of the monitor was unusually quiet.

Zhou Mingqian is reading the script.

Yu An noticed that he hadn't turned the page for a while, perhaps he was considering the scene.

She made a cup of milk tea and brought it over, asking softly, "Director Zhou, did you already know that Xi Jia and President Mo were a couple?"

Zhou Mingqian raised his eyelids, "When did you become so gossipy?"

Yu An smiled faintly, "I'm just happy." She was happy for Xi Jia.

Zhou Mingqian finally turned a page of the script. He didn't know which scene it was; he hadn't been paying attention.

He turned his head to look at Yu An: "What are you happy about regarding their business? It's none of your concern."

"Eat salty radish but worry about nothing."

Yu An bit her lip slightly, not refuting her boss. If the boss was in a bad mood, then whatever he said was fine.

The milk tea was on the table, but Zhou Mingqian didn't drink it.

Yu An handed it to him again, saying, "Director Zhou, sweets make people feel good."

Zhou Mingqian was displeased and glared at her, "Which eye of yours sees me in a bad mood?"

Yu An blinked, not refuting. She could only tell a lie, "I'm in a bad mood. My crush, Mo Yushen, is already taken. None of the girls in our crew are in a good mood."

She took the milk tea and drank it herself.

After that, Yu An stopped making a fuss and sat quietly next to Zhou Mingqian, waiting for his boss to give him instructions.

Zhou Mingqian closed the script and looked at Yu An. "You think I'm in a bad mood because I like Xi Jia?"

Yu An waved his hands repeatedly, "I didn't think so. You said it yourself."

Zhou Mingqian: "..." Even drinking cold water is a problem today. He stood up, turned the script upside down on Yu An's head, and walked to the shore of the water.

Yu An remained silent, taking the script off her head and setting it aside. She offered a minute of sympathy to the heartbroken man, deciding not to stoop to his level.

Zhou Mingqian asked the staff on the shore to pull another small electric boat over so he could meet up with the cameraman and finalize the scene.

Xi Jia was carefully tending to her treasures; all her secrets were exposed to the sun today. Luckily, the sun was shining brightly, and she estimated they would be mostly dry by the afternoon.

She looked up and saw Zhou Mingqian boarding the ship. "Director Zhou, wait for me." It was her own voice, but it sounded very distant.

Zhou Mingqian: "What?" His tone was as irritating as ever.

Xi Jia saw Zhou Mingqian open his mouth, but even though he was so close, she hadn't heard him. Her ears felt muffled. She took a deep breath, trying her best to calm herself down. "Wait for me, I'm coming too."

She turned and called to Mo Yushen, "Honey, can you watch my notes for me?" She slung the backpack she had brought from the hotel over her shoulder and headed straight for the small boat on the shore.

Jiang Qin sat on the stone bench, with her back to the sun, reciting her lines.

Next to her was Xi Jia's notebook; a gust of wind blew, lifting the pages.

"Did you lose your mind today?" Jiang Qin looked up, her eyes slightly narrowed, unable to understand Mo Yushen.

She teased Mo Yushen: "The one who's lost their mind is Zhou Mingqian. Why are you getting involved? Didn't you say before that you didn't want to gossip about Xi Jia? What's wrong with you today? You're not afraid of what people will say anymore?"

Mo Yushen had considered this before, but didn't make it public.

After a month and a half, everyone had seen just how capable Xi Jia really was.

For her, the screenwriter, their relationship was merely icing on the cake. But for her, an insecure patient, it was a lifeline.

Mo Yushen bent down, turned over the half-dry page, and weighed it down with a stone.

Jiang Qin waited for Mo Yushen to answer, but he remained silent for a long time.

Not far away, Xiang Luo was playing in the water.

Xi Jia came out of the water, completely soaked, but she didn't seem that cold. So she took off her shoes, sat on the shore, and wanted to try it herself.

As soon as she put her foot into the lake, she shivered from the cold.

The water in the mountains is exceptionally cold and icy.

Xi Jia was so wet just now, yet she was still able to endure it.

He lifted his foot, not daring to touch the water.

Turning my head unintentionally, I saw Mo Yushen's figure, patiently looking at Xi Jia's notes.

The sleeves of his white shirt were rolled up, revealing his muscular forearms.

The forceful way he held Xi Jia in his arms just now must have made countless girls present envious.

A few days ago, some fans in the crew were daydreaming about what it would feel like to be held by Mo Yushen.

In the moment Xiang Luo was lost in thought, Jiang Qin happened to look over, and their eyes met. The disdain in Jiang Qin's eyes was undisguised.
